
A 21-year-old man was shot and robbed in Hyde Park, as reported by the St. Louis Metropolitan Police Department. The incident is said to have taken place yesterday in the 3700 block of Vest Ave. The victim was allegedly meeting a so-called "friend" whom he could not name, when the man turned on him, pulling out a weapon and declaring a robbery. In an attempt to escape, the victim was shot in the shoulder.
According to the official police statement of the St. Louis Metropolitan Police Department, the altercation occurred around 5 p.m. "The 21-year-old told officers he was at the location around 5 p.m. to meet a 'friend,'" the report details, but the encounter quickly escalated from an innocent meeting to a violent confrontation. It appears that the suspect, identity unknown, capitalized on the victim's vulnerability, taking his property before fleeing the scene.
The man injured in the event was taken privately to a hospital and has been listed in stable condition. This information comes directly from records of the responding authorities, with ongoing efforts to investigate and apprehend the suspect involved in this criminal act.
